Fixes requested by the Obsidian Team:
- Changed to Platform.isMacOS to detect operating system
- Changed all UI text to "Sentence case"
- Changed to vault.process to update file contents
- Switched to getBasePath() for FileSystemAdapter
Also improved the right-click menu on Windows PCs, and added separate paths for external app on Mac and Windows if you use Obsidian cross-platform.